// TRANSCRIPT

Sync
To do TrainerRoad workouts outside on a Garmin Edge head unit, sync your Garmin Connect and TrainerRoad accounts on TrainerRoad.com.

Calendar
From the TrainerRoad Calendar, select "Do Outside" for an existing workout in your training plan, or select which days of the week you typically train outside when adding a training plan to your calendar.

Custom Screen Building
For the best training experience using Garmin Edge 30 series devices, create a custom workout screen with 4 fields: Elapsed Time, Three Second Power, Lap Power and Time to Go. Once the custom workout screen is created, make sure it is in the first screen slot.

Load Workout
Access your Training Plan to view today’s outside workout and select start.

Start Workout
Once you’ve started your workout, swipe over to the custom screen, and refer back to the standard screen if you need to be reminded of your target power.

End of warmup transition
If it takes you longer to get to your training location than your scheduled warmup, that’s okay. Continue to warmup until you are in the terrain you plan to use for your intervals, then press lap when you are ready to start your first work interval.

Short vs. long
Workouts with longer, more spaced out intervals will require you to hit the Lap Button to start your next work interval, while workouts with short, closely spaced intervals will make it easier on you by automatically moving through the workout without requiring you to press the Lap Button before each work interval. Review your workout prior to starting to know which structure your workout follows.

Workout Completion
Once your workout is complete, you can swipe outside of the workout screen and continue your ride. Once the ride is complete, it will be ready for viewing and analysis in your TrainerRoad Calendar.
